#bd0054 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bd0054 is composed of 74.1% red, 0%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 55.6%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 333.3 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 37.1%. #bd0054 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00a8 with #7b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

● #bd0054 color description : Strong pink.
#bd0054 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bd0054 has RGB values of R:189, G:0,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.56,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12386388.

Shades and Tints of #bd0054
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0006 is the darkest color, while #fff8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#bd0054
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#66575e is the less saturated color, while #bd0054 is the most saturated one.
